Mediocrity

Product teams launch mediocre products when we fail to learn as we build. We build for months, even years, never truly learning if we are building the right thing.

“What differentiates the success stories from the failures is that the successful entrepreneurs had the foresight, the ability, and the tools to discover which parts of their plans were working brilliantly and which were misguided, and adapt their strategies accordingly.” – Eric Ries, The Lean Startup.

First if we want to launch successful products, we need to find ways to continually learn as we build by using mockups, prototypes, MVPs, releasing early and often, and other such tools.

Second, we need to create space for adaptability. We can’t blind ourselves to negative feedback or information which contradicts our original idea. We need to be adaptable.
